I am doing more small production runs of small dovetailed boxes,
between 6-9" length of sides and 3-5" high. Currently I do all the
sanding after assembly with a ROS (the small Festool) and then a bit
of hand sanding and with a stack of 20 boxes to go through 3 grits
it's not the least bit fun. If I could totally eliminate the ROS and
go straight to hand sanding that would be fantastic.


Oh man - I didn't read this part of your post. If you're doing even
small production runs than I would run - not walk - RUN to your
nearest dealer to get yourself an edge sander. It's a HUGE timesaver,
and the quality improves too. It's a win-win by far.
